Tanzania - Whole Fresh Cow Milk Producing Population

Since 2014, Tanzania Whole Fresh Cow Milk Producing Population increased 0.1% year on year. With 7,034,411 Heads in 2019, the country was ranked number 7 comparing other countries in Whole Fresh Cow Milk Producing Population. Tanzania is overtaken by South Sudan, which was number 6 with 8,082,664 Heads and is followed by Russia at 6,666,987 Heads. India ranked the highest with 53,000,000 Heads in 2019, a growth of 0.3% compared to 2018. Brazil, Pakistan and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Martinique recorded the best 5 years average growth at +26.9% per year, while Jamaica witnessed the worst performance at -17.2% per year.
